Fanatics announces new digital sports innovation centre in Hyderabad; to boost AI initiatives and high-impact workforce growth
Fanatics will double its technical workforce in Hyderabad and also move into a new, larger office space in Hitec City by 2026
Published Date - 28 February 2025, 05:55 PM
Hyderabad: Fanatics, a digital sports platform with 22,000 employees in more than 80 locations, have announced the strengthening of its leadership, increasing in technical hiring, and expanding its footprint within India.
As part of its global expansion and commitment to enhancing the fan experience, Fanatics will double its technical workforce in Hyderabad, growing from 250 to over 500 employees within the next two years.
In addition to the hiring growth, Fanatics will move into a new, larger office space in Hitec City by 2026, which will be three times the size of its current location.
To lead the Hyderabad office, Fanatics has appointed Abhishek Dhasmana as vice-president and general manager. Abhishek joins Fanatics from Indeed, where he held the position of site head for the company’s India development centre.
Matthias Spycher, interim chief technology officer of Fanatics, said, “We are committed to building a sustainable and high-performing organisation in Hyderabad, with strong leadership that drives high-impact technical projects and develops innovative products.”
